Ah Chui Seafood @ Paya Terubong Penang
This restaurant has since become our regular haunt whenever we crave for seafood. On another visit, we had several different dishes. We started off with the red snapper. The portion was huge and was prepared in two techniques. The fish head was cooked in a claypot with a flavorful soya sauce gravy whereas the tail section was grilled in spicy chili sauce.
This claypot & panggang red snapper dish cost RM39.
Those craving for prawns should go for the plate of Kam Heong Prawn. The prawns were stir-fried with their special sauce along with onions and curry leaves. The prawns were very fresh and juicy.
Kam Heong Prawn – RM22
We topped off the dinner with Stir-Fried Kangkung and some Chinese tea, rounding off a bill of RM74!
Besides the Chinese tea, we enjoyed cooling strawberry sherbet and Coffee Latte concocted by the owner’s daughter. She is more than happy to prepare these specialty drinks to share with her customers whenever she is free.

This casual seafood spot is located further up from the Paya Terubong You Tiao (crullers) stall. After the stall, continue driving pass the Lintang Paya Terubong/Jalan Paya Terubong traffic lights. Be on the look out for the Fire Brigade station (on your left) followed by rows of shop-houses. You will not miss this ‘chu char’ as it is visible from afar with its big signboard hanging right above the shop. Click here for the Map Location.
